Frodo Backpacks, Inc. manufacture small-batch backpacks specifically designed for high intensity adventures, such as a perilous journey to Mount Doom to save the world. They use a traditional method of allocating the manufacturing overhead costs. The total estimated manufacturing overheads costs is $560,160. The total estimated cost driver is 22,000 machine hours.

During the month of March, Frodo Backpacks worked on two different jobs. Job M-203 was completed, but not sold. Job D-682 was finished and sold. Data for the jobs are as follows:

Job M-203 Job D-682
Beginning balance $28,500 $26,200
Direct materials $46,720 $38,900
Direct labor costs $33,400 $40,500
Actual machine hours 5,600 machine hours 6,300 machine hours

1.Using the information provided, please calculate the total applied manufacturing overhead costs for Job M-203. Round your answer to the nearest whole dollar. Do not use the "$" sign.

2.Using the information provided, please calculate the total applied manufacturing overhead costs for Job D-682. Round your answer to the nearest whole dollar. Do not use the "$" sign.

3.Using the information provided, please calculate the finished goods inventory ending balance for March. Round your answer to the nearest whole dollar. Do not use the "$" sign.

4.Using the information provided, please calculate the cost of goods sold for March. Round your answer to the nearest whole dollar. Do not use the "$" sign.
